forked from ariadne/pkgconf
stdinc.h: fix build with mingw (#122)
Fixes this build error with mingw: ... | compilation terminated. | In file included from ../pkgconf-1.3.7/libpkgconf/libpkgconf.h:19:0, | from ../pkgconf-1.3.7/libpkgconf/audit.c:16: | ../pkgconf-1.3.7/libpkgconf/stdinc.h:36:12: fatal error: BaseTsd.h: No such file or directory | # include <BaseTsd.h> Signed-off-by: Maxin B. John <maxin.john@intel.com>feature/tap-sh
parent
38cda5e584
commit
74666bff38
|
@ -33,11 +33,19 @@
|
||||||
# include <malloc.h>
|
# include <malloc.h>
|
||||||
# define PATH_DEV_NULL "nul"
|
# define PATH_DEV_NULL "nul"
|
||||||
# ifndef ssize_t
|
# ifndef ssize_t
|
||||||
|
# ifndef __MINGW32__
|
||||||
# include <BaseTsd.h>
|
# include <BaseTsd.h>
|
||||||
|
# else
|
||||||
|
# include <basetsd.h>
|
||||||
|
# endif
|
||||||
# define ssize_t SSIZE_T
|
# define ssize_t SSIZE_T
|
||||||
# endif
|
# endif
|
||||||
|
# ifndef __MINGW32__
|
||||||
# include "win-dirent.h"
|
# include "win-dirent.h"
|
||||||
# else
|
# else
|
||||||
|
# include <dirent.h>
|
||||||
|
# endif
|
||||||
|
#else
|
||||||
# define PATH_DEV_NULL "/dev/null"
|
# define PATH_DEV_NULL "/dev/null"
|
||||||
# include <dirent.h>
|
# include <dirent.h>
|
||||||
# include <unistd.h>
|
# include <unistd.h>
|
||||||
|
|
Loading…
Reference in New Issue